Onder de voorkant van Lepahy zitten 2 lijnvolgers.
Deze sensoren kunnen herkennen of de ondergrond wit(licht) of zwart(donker) is.
Als de ondergrond wit is, zal de sensor de waarde "1" naar Leaphy sturen.
Als de ondergrond zwart is, zal de sensor de waarde "0" naar Leaphy sturen.
Je kan dit makkelijk testen, er zit een lampje op de sensor. Probeer maar.
De linker lijnsensor zit op "digipin 14".
De rechter lijnsensor zit "digipin 15".
Om een lijn te volgen hebben we 4 situaties:
Bedenk wat Leaphy in elke situatie moet doen.
Beide sensoren zien wit. Leaphy moet naar ....
De linker sensor ziet zwart, de rechter ziet wit. Leaphy moet naar ....
De linker sensor ziet wit, de rechter ziet zwart. Leaphy moet naar ....
Beide sensoren zien zwart. Leaphy moet ....
We bouwen eerst een programma om te testen of we de 4 situaties kunnen herkennen. Dit doen we door de LED voor elke situatie een andere kleur te laten schijnen.
Bekijk het blok hieronder.
deze is samengesteld uit verschillende blokken.
Leaphy kijkt naar "digipin 14" EN "digipin 15" tegelijk. Pas als beide pinnen de waarde "1" geeft, dan gaat de LED branden.
Maak nu het programma hiernaast. Zorg dat de LED in elke situatie een andere kleur geeft.
Je kan nu Leaphy aanpassen zodat het de juiste kant oprijdt als het een zwarte lijn tegenkomt.
Probeer het uit en verander de waarden van de motor totdat Leaphy de zwarte lijn kan volgen.
Bekijk het laatste blok eens goed, wat moet Leaphy volgens jou doen als hij bij 2 sensoren een zwarte lijn ziet?
Bedenk zelf een opdracht wat Leaphy dan moet doen en probeer het uit.
Copyright © 2023 Schmidt Technologies.
Powered by Schmidt Technologies.